  8. Also, #survHEhmc (to run Bayesian modelling for survival analysis in HTA using HMC/pre-compiled @mcmc_stan models) and #survHMCinla (to run some Bayesian models for survival analysis in HTA using INLA) are now updated on GitHub and available via #drat repo)

    github.com/giabaio/survHEhmc

    github.com/giabaio/survHEinla
